UPDATED DEVILS OFFSEASON GAME PLAN AS OF JUNE 28 MORNING. THE DAY AFTER THE DRAFT.
I do not want to see a full blown rebuild. A 1-2 year transition to get a youth movement in full effect isn't a terrible idea though.
The main reason I do not want to see a rebuild is this: Cory Schneider is too good of a goalie to sit through a rebuild. In my opinion, the top NHL goaltenders in order are: Price, Lundqvist, Rinne, Schneider, Rask, Quick.... You can't have a top 5 goalie on your team, and try to rebuild at the same time because Schneider alone will pull the Devils up 4-6 spots in the standings, therefore weakening our shot at the #1 draft pick.
With the recent moves of the Palmieri acquisition and the drafting of Pavel Zacha, Mackenzie Blackwood, Blake Speers, Colton White, and Brett Seney, here is my opinions on these moves, and how I want to see the Devils go about the rest of their offseason:
I am in full support of the Palmieri trade: basically traded 20 games of Jaromir Jagr for Kyle Palmieri. Great trade.
I am in full support of the Zacha pick: before the draft, I would've preferred Barzal, or trading the 6 and other pieces to get O'Reilly and the 10th. Now after seeing Barzal drop so far, it makes me feel a whole lot better about Zacha. Im excited for this. However, I still wish there was a way we could've acquired O'Reilly. The guy is 24 and is a stud.
I am in full support of the Mackenzie Blackwood pick: Sure we needed forwards, but if Devils believed that Blackwood was the best player available, and they also acquired another 3rd round pick next year in the process, I like it. Devils needed another goalie in the system, and I'm happy we have a top prospect goalie rather than a middle level prospect.
I am a bit disappointed that Gomez won't be back, but I can understand the decision. I have no problem with Bernier, Harrold, Fraser, Havlat, Ryder, and Salvador not coming back.
Here's where to go from here in my opinion:
Resign Larsson (I'm thinking maybe like 6 years in the 3-4.5 million per season range, kinda like the Henrique deal)
Resign Gelinas for one or two years, low cost
On July 1:
Sign one of (Paul Martin, Johnny Oduya, Andrei Sekera, or Francois Beauchemin) to a 1-3 year contract
Sign UFA forward Michael Frolik to a 3-5 year contract.

* What does everyone think Shero should do with Zacha? I vote to let him play in our first 9 NHL games. If he's visibly ready for the NHL, and ready to contribute to a top 6 forward position, they should keep him. And if he's clearly not ready, send him back to junior and don't waste an ELC year. If he stays, and then his play happens to decline throughout the season, they can still just send him back to junior, only wasting 1 year of the ELC.
